Pure water boils at 212°F at sea level (at higher altitudes, water boils at lower temperatures). When a mixture has less water and more of another substance, such as sugar, the mixture boils at a higher temperature. Thus, a sugar mixture's boiling temperature tells us how concentrated it has become..
